Home
last modified time | relevance | path

Searched defs:mbs (Results 1 – 25 of 51) sorted by relevance

123

/petsc/src/mat/impls/sbaij/seq/
H A Dsbaijfact2.c13 PetscInt mbs = a->mbs, *ai = a->i, *aj = a->j; in MatSolve_SeqSBAIJ_N_inplace() local
92 …Ordering(const PetscInt *ai, const PetscInt *aj, const MatScalar *aa, PetscInt mbs, PetscInt bs, P… in MatForwardSolve_SeqSBAIJ_N_NaturalOrdering()
124 …Ordering(const PetscInt *ai, const PetscInt *aj, const MatScalar *aa, PetscInt mbs, PetscInt bs, P… in MatBackwardSolve_SeqSBAIJ_N_NaturalOrdering()
152 const PetscInt mbs = a->mbs, *ai = a->i, *aj = a->j; in MatSolve_SeqSBAIJ_N_NaturalOrdering_inplace() local
178 const PetscInt mbs = a->mbs, *ai = a->i, *aj = a->j; in MatForwardSolve_SeqSBAIJ_N_NaturalOrdering_inplace() local
198 const PetscInt mbs = a->mbs, *ai = a->i, *aj = a->j; in MatBackwardSolve_SeqSBAIJ_N_NaturalOrdering_inplace() local
219 const PetscInt mbs = a->mbs, *ai = a->i, *aj = a->j, *r, *vj; in MatSolve_SeqSBAIJ_7_inplace() local
336 …Ordering(const PetscInt *ai, const PetscInt *aj, const MatScalar *aa, PetscInt mbs, PetscScalar *x) in MatForwardSolve_SeqSBAIJ_7_NaturalOrdering()
385 …Ordering(const PetscInt *ai, const PetscInt *aj, const MatScalar *aa, PetscInt mbs, PetscScalar *x) in MatBackwardSolve_SeqSBAIJ_7_NaturalOrdering()
435 const PetscInt mbs = a->mbs, *ai = a->i, *aj = a->j; in MatSolve_SeqSBAIJ_7_NaturalOrdering_inplace() local
[all …]
H A Dsbaij2.c11 PetscInt brow, i, j, k, l, mbs, n, *nidx, isz, bcol, bcol_max, start, end, *ai, *aj, bs; in MatIncreaseOverlap_SeqSBAIJ() local
293 PetscInt mbs = a->mbs, i, n, cval, j, jmin; in MatMult_SeqSBAIJ_2() local
347 PetscInt mbs = a->mbs, i, n, cval, j, jmin; in MatMult_SeqSBAIJ_3() local
405 PetscInt mbs = a->mbs, i, n, cval, j, jmin; in MatMult_SeqSBAIJ_4() local
467 PetscInt mbs = a->mbs, i, n, cval, j, jmin; in MatMult_SeqSBAIJ_5() local
533 PetscInt mbs = a->mbs, i, n, cval, j, jmin; in MatMult_SeqSBAIJ_6() local
603 PetscInt mbs = a->mbs, i, n, cval, j, jmin; in MatMult_SeqSBAIJ_7() local
679 PetscInt mbs = a->mbs, i, bs = A->rmap->bs, j, n, bs2 = a->bs2, ncols, k; in MatMult_SeqSBAIJ_N() local
752 PetscInt mbs = a->mbs, i, n, cval, j, jmin; in MatMultAdd_SeqSBAIJ_1() local
805 PetscInt mbs = a->mbs, i, n, cval, j, jmin; in MatMultAdd_SeqSBAIJ_2() local
[all …]
H A Dsro.c34 const PetscInt mbs = a->mbs; in MatReorderingSeqSBAIJ() local
H A Dsbaijfact.c10 PetscInt mbs = fact->mbs, bs = F->rmap->bs, i, nneg_tmp, npos_tmp, *fi = fact->diag; in MatGetInertia_SeqSBAIJ() local
43 PetscInt i, mbs = a->mbs, *jutmp, bs = A->rmap->bs, bs2 = a->bs2; in MatCholeskyFactorSymbolic_SeqSBAIJ_MSR() local
227 PetscInt i, mbs = a->mbs, bs = A->rmap->bs, reallocs = 0, prow; in MatCholeskyFactorSymbolic_SeqSBAIJ() local
392 PetscInt i, mbs = a->mbs, bs = A->rmap->bs, reallocs = 0, prow; in MatCholeskyFactorSymbolic_SeqSBAIJ_inplace() local
562 const PetscInt *ai, *aj, *perm_ptr, mbs = a->mbs, *bi = b->i, *bj = b->j; in MatCholeskyFactorNumeric_SeqSBAIJ_N() local
736 PetscInt i, j, mbs = a->mbs, *bi = b->i, *bj = b->j; in MatCholeskyFactorNumeric_SeqSBAIJ_N_NaturalOrdering() local
870 PetscInt i, j, mbs = a->mbs, *bi = b->i, *bj = b->j; in MatCholeskyFactorNumeric_SeqSBAIJ_2() local
1049 PetscInt i, j, mbs = a->mbs, *bi = b->i, *bj = b->j; in MatCholeskyFactorNumeric_SeqSBAIJ_2_NaturalOrdering() local
1194 PetscInt *a2anew, i, j, mbs = a->mbs, *bi = b->i, *bj = b->j, *bcol; in MatCholeskyFactorNumeric_SeqSBAIJ_1_inplace() local
1350 PetscInt i, j, mbs = A->rmap->n, *bi = b->i, *bj = b->j, *bdiag = b->diag, *bjtmp; in MatCholeskyFactorNumeric_SeqSBAIJ_1_NaturalOrdering() local
[all …]
H A Daijsbaij.c11 PetscInt bs = A->rmap->bs, bs2 = bs * bs, mbs = A->rmap->N / bs, diagcnt = 0; in MatConvert_SeqSBAIJ_SeqAIJ() local
241 PetscInt bs = A->rmap->bs, bs2 = bs * bs, mbs = m / bs; in MatConvert_SeqSBAIJ_SeqBAIJ() local
335 PetscInt bs = A->rmap->bs, bs2 = bs * bs, mbs = m / bs; in MatConvert_SeqBAIJ_SeqSBAIJ() local
H A Dsbaijfact4.c10 PetscInt i, j, mbs = a->mbs, *bi = b->i, *bj = b->j; in MatCholeskyFactorNumeric_SeqSBAIJ_3_NaturalOrdering() local
H A Dsbaijfact5.c10 PetscInt i, j, mbs = a->mbs, *bi = b->i, *bj = b->j; in MatCholeskyFactorNumeric_SeqSBAIJ_4_NaturalOrdering() local
H A Dsbaijfact8.c10 PetscInt i, j, mbs = a->mbs, *bi = b->i, *bj = b->j; in MatCholeskyFactorNumeric_SeqSBAIJ_5_NaturalOrdering() local
H A Dsbaijfact3.c9 const PetscInt *ai, *aj, *perm_ptr, mbs = a->mbs, *bi = b->i, *bj = b->j; in MatCholeskyFactorNumeric_SeqSBAIJ_3() local
H A Dsbaijfact6.c9 const PetscInt *ai, *aj, *perm_ptr, mbs = a->mbs, *bi = b->i, *bj = b->j; in MatCholeskyFactorNumeric_SeqSBAIJ_4() local
H A Dsbaijfact7.c9 const PetscInt *ai, *aj, *perm_ptr, mbs = a->mbs, *bi = b->i, *bj = b->j; in MatCholeskyFactorNumeric_SeqSBAIJ_5() local
/petsc/src/mat/impls/baij/seq/
H A Dbaij2.c242 PetscInt mbs, i, n; in MatMult_SeqBAIJ_1() local
288 PetscInt mbs, i, *idx, *ii, j, n, *ridx = NULL; in MatMult_SeqBAIJ_2() local
340 PetscInt mbs, i, *idx, *ii, j, n, *ridx = NULL; in MatMult_SeqBAIJ_3() local
401 PetscInt mbs, i, *idx, *ii, j, n, *ridx = NULL; in MatMult_SeqBAIJ_4() local
463 PetscInt mbs, i, j, n; in MatMult_SeqBAIJ_5() local
528 PetscInt mbs, i, *idx, *ii, j, n, *ridx = NULL; in MatMult_SeqBAIJ_6() local
599 PetscInt mbs, i, *idx, *ii, j, n, *ridx = NULL; in MatMult_SeqBAIJ_7() local
674 PetscInt mbs, i, bs = A->rmap->bs, j, n, bs2 = a->bs2; in MatMult_SeqBAIJ_9_AVX2() local
827 PetscInt mbs, i, j, k, n, *ridx = NULL; in MatMult_SeqBAIJ_11() local
911 PetscInt mbs, i, j, k, n, *ridx = NULL; in MatMult_SeqBAIJ_12_ver1() local
[all …]
/petsc/src/ksp/pc/impls/pbjacobi/cuda/
H A Dpbjacobi_cuda.cu6 __global__ static void MatMultBatched(PetscInt bs, PetscInt mbs, const PetscScalar *A, const PetscS… in MatMultBatched()
40 const PetscInt bs = jac->bs, mbs = jac->mbs; in PCApplyOrTranspose_PBJacobi_CUDA() local
/petsc/src/mat/utils/
H A Dcompressedrow.c30 …at A, PetscInt nrows, Mat_CompressedRow *compressedrow, PetscInt *ai, PetscInt mbs, PetscReal rati… in MatCheckCompressedRow()
/petsc/src/ksp/pc/impls/pbjacobi/
H A Dpbjacobi.h10 PetscInt bs, mbs; /* block size (bs), and number of blocks (mbs) */ member
/petsc/src/mat/impls/sbaij/mpi/
H A Dmmsbaij.c11 PetscInt bs = mat->rmap->bs, *stmp, mbs = sbaij->mbs, vec_size, nt; in MatSetUpMultiply_MPISBAIJ() local
186 PetscInt i, j, mbs = Bbaij->mbs, n = A->cmap->N, col, *garray = baij->garray; in MatDisAssemble_MPISBAIJ() local
H A Dmpisbaij.c712 PetscInt brow, bcol, col, bs = baij->A->rmap->bs, row, grow, gcol, mbs = amat->mbs; in MatNorm_MPISBAIJ() local
928 … PetscInt M = mat->rmap->N, N = mat->cmap->N, *ai, *aj, col, i, j, k, *rvals, mbs = baij->mbs; in MatView_MPISBAIJ_ASCIIorDraworSocket() local
1019 PetscInt mbs = a->mbs, bs = A->rmap->bs; in MatMult_MPISBAIJ_Hermitian() local
1053 PetscInt mbs = a->mbs, bs = A->rmap->bs; in MatMult_MPISBAIJ() local
1086 PetscInt mbs = a->mbs, bs = A->rmap->bs; in MatMultAdd_MPISBAIJ_Hermitian() local
1119 PetscInt mbs = a->mbs, bs = A->rmap->bs; in MatMultAdd_MPISBAIJ() local
1189 PetscInt max = 1, mbs = mat->mbs, tmp; in MatGetRow_MPISBAIJ() local
1901 PetscInt i, mbs, Mbs; in MatMPISBAIJSetPreallocation_MPISBAIJ() local
2401 PetscInt len = 0, nt, bs = matin->rmap->bs, mbs = oldmat->mbs; in MatDuplicate_MPISBAIJ() local
2513 PetscInt i, bs, mbs, *bi, *bj, brow, j, ncols, krow, kcol, col, row, Mbs, bcol; in MatGetRowMaxAbs_MPISBAIJ() local
[all …]
/petsc/src/mat/tests/
H A Dex141.c9 PetscInt i, bs = 2, mbs, m, block, d_nz = 6, col[3]; in main() local
H A Dex55.c9 PetscInt i, j, ntypes, bs, mbs, m, block, d_nz = 6, o_nz = 3, col[3], row, verbose = 0; in main() local
H A Dex77.c10 PetscInt n, mbs = 16, bs = 1, nz = 3, prob = 2, i, j, col[3], row, Ii, J, n1; in main() local
H A Dex76.c10 PetscInt n, mbs = 16, bs = 1, nz = 3, prob = 1, i, j, col[3], block, row, Ii, J, n1, lvl; in main() local
H A Dex92.c11 …PetscInt bs = 1, mbs = 10, ov = 1, i, j, k, *rows, *cols, nd = 2, *idx, rstart, rend, sz, M, … in main() local
H A Dex75.c12 …PetscInt n, col[3], n1, block, row, i, j, i2, j2, Ii, J, rstart, rend, bs = 1, mbs = 16, d_nz =… in main() local
/petsc/src/mat/impls/aij/seq/
H A Dfdaij.c64 PetscInt i, j, nrows, nbcols, brows = c->brows, bcols = c->bcols, mbs = c->m, nis = c->ncolors; in MatFDColoringSetUpBlocked_AIJ_Private() local
178 …PetscInt i, n, nrows, mbs = c->m, j, k, m, ncols, col, nis = iscoloring->n, *rowhit, bs,… in MatFDColoringSetUp_SeqXAIJ() local
/petsc/src/ksp/pc/impls/pbjacobi/kokkos/
H A Dpbjacobi_kok.kokkos.cxx38 const PetscInt bs = jac->bs, mbs = jac->mbs, bs2 = bs * bs; in PCApplyOrTranspose_PBJacobi_Kokkos() local

123